The ultrasonic generators of the AGM Pro series are designed for installation in automation lines, special machines and automatic welding systems. In these systems, they perform demanding welding and separation tasks such as ultrasonic welding of thermoplastic plastics and molded parts, as well as ultrasonic cutting of nonwoven fabrics and technical textile products or food products such as cheese, wraps or pies. Thanks to their narrow width, they can be installed in control cabinets without taking up much space. In addition, they are equipped with an optimized cooling system.
COMMUNICATION AND INTEGRATION
Commissioning is carried out via the system’s PLC. Thanks to certified interchangeable modules for Fieldbus interfaces, the generator can be seamlessly integrated into existing systems. Communication modules are available for PROFIBUS, PROFINET, DeviceNet, EtherNet/IP, EtherCAT and CANopen Fieldbuses. In addition, the ultrasonic generators can be integrated and configured via RS485 and digital and analog inputs and outputs.
OPERATING CONCEPT
In addition to the PLC, you can also use our ProConnect Web application to enter and change parameters or export and analyze data. Real-time status monitoring is also carried out through these two options.
AGM Pro is generally used in the following areas:
Ultrasonic welding, cutting, punching, riveting and edge forming of plastics
Embedding and countersinking of metal parts using ultrasonic technology
Ultrasonic sealing of packaging
Ultrasonic welding, cutting or separation cutting of technical textiles and nonwoven fabrics
Ultrasonic cutting of food products, textiles, foils and rubber
3.5″ color touchscreen
In addition to the ProConnect Web application and PLC, ultrasonic generators can also be operated via a 3.5″ color touchscreen. The start window always displays the current values and the status of the device.
ProConnect Web application
With the ProConnect Web application, you can easily operate the AGM Pro from a computer or mobile terminal device. This allows you to always keep track of the device status, current parameters and settings. During the welding process, current values are displayed as a diagram. This makes the values immediately available for analysis. The ProConnect Web application also offers a remote maintenance option.
Amplitude control
The amplitude can be adjusted between 15% and 100% in 1% increments to achieve a better welding result.
Communication interfaces
AGM Pro generators can be seamlessly integrated into existing systems via Fieldbus interfaces. Applicable and certified* communication protocols: PROFINET*, PROFIBUS, DeviceNet*, EtherNet/IP*, EtherCAT* and CANopen*. In addition, communication with ultrasonic generators can be established via RS485 and digital and analog inputs and outputs.
User management
Regardless of whether the generators are operated via the touchscreen or the ProConnect Web application, multi-level user management provides greater security. This allows a technician to have read and write permissions, while a user has read-only access. The password can be changed by technicians at any time.
Maximum repeatability
You can create and save eight parameter data sets, thereby increasing the repeatability of your processes.

TECHNICAL SPECIFICATIONS
Operating Frequency : 20 kHz, 30 kHz, 35 kHz, 40 kHz or 70 kHz
Output Power : 100 W, 400 W, 500 W, 750 W, 800 W, 900 W, 1000 W, 1500 W, 2000 W or 3000 W
Operating Modes :
• Time mode
• Energy mode
• Time and energy mode
• Time or energy mode
• Continuous
• Contact shutdown
Communication and Interfaces
PROFINET*
• PROFIBUS*
• DeviceNet*
• EtherNet/IP*
• EtherCAT*
• CANopen*
• RS485
• Digital inputs and outputs
• Analog inputs and outputs
*As an interchangeable module
Mains Supply : 230 V AC ± 10%, 50 / 60 Hz – 24 V DC separate power supply for the control unit
Amplitude : Adjustable between 15% – 100%, changeable in 1% increments
Weight : 4 kg
